Gian Antonio Grassi
Gian Antonio Grassi (died 1602) was a Roman Catholic prelate who served as Bishop of Faenza (1585–1602).[1][2]

Biography
On 18 March 1585, Gian Antonio Grassi was appointed during the papacy of Pope Gregory XIII as Bishop of Faenza.[1][2] He served as Bishop of Faenza until his death on 30 July 1602.[2]
